Abstract
Recent studies involving large errors in static electricity meters when exposed to step changes in the current waveform are reviewed. Triggered by these findings, a joint European research project has recently started to further evaluate these effects. A description is given of this pre-normative research program which aims to provide evidence and techniques to resolve this unsatisfactory meter error situation. The need or otherwise for a regulatory and standardization response to these large meter errors is discussed
